Wyndham Hotels & Resorts (NYSE:WH – Get Free Report) declared a quarterly dividend on Thursday, August 13th. Investors of record on Tuesday, September 15th will be given a dividend of 0.43 per share on Wednesday, September 30th. This represents a c) d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 2.5%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Tuesday, September 15th.
Wyndham Hotels & Resorts has increased its dividend payment by an average of 0.2%per year over the last three years and has increased its dividend annually for the last 5 consecutive years. Wyndham Hotels & Resorts has a payout ratio of 32.2% meaning its dividend is sufficiently covered by earnings. Analysts expect Wyndham Hotels & Resorts to earn $5.44 per share next year, which means the company should continue to be able to cover its $1.72 annual dividend with an expected future payout ratio of 31.6%.

Wyndham Hotels & Resorts Company Profile
Wyndham Hotels & Resorts, Inc is a global hotel franchising company that provides branding, marketing, reservation, loyalty and other support services to independently owned and operated hotels. Its portfolio is focused primarily on the economy and midscale segments of the lodging industry.
The company’s brand portfolio includes well-known names such as Wyndham, Ramada, Days Inn, Super 8, La Quinta, Travelodge, Baymont, Microtel, Wingate, AmericInn, Econo Lodge, Howard Johnson, Dolce and Registry Collection Hotels.
